Course summary

The study of a foreign language will allow students to: • Develop a high level of communication skills and linguistic competence in the target language • Gain a useful insight into another culture and reflect on various aspects of the society in which the target language is spoken • Develop study skills as a preparation for the world of work • Enhance employment prospects, to facilitate foreign travel and experience the enjoyment and motivation of improving linguistic levels. What is the structure of the course Theme 1 Aspects of French/Spanish/German speaking society: current trends (Year 1) Theme 2 Artistic culture in the French/Spanish/German speaking world (Year 1). Theme 3 Aspects of French/Spanish/German speaking society: current issues (Year 2) Theme 4 Aspects of political life in the French/Spanish/German speaking world (Year 2) Students must also undertake an independent research project of their own choice and study either one book and one film or two books from a prescribed list over the course of the two years.

Entry requirements

We are delighted that you are considering Halliford Sixth Form. Entry into Sixth Form is based on an interview, a satisfactory report from the previous school, and a minimum of 5 GCSEs at Grade 5 or above including English and Mathematics. It is a requirement that students achieve at least a Grade 6 at GCSE in the subjects that they wish to study at A Level.

How you'll be assessed

Exam based assessment of Year 1 and Year 2 Paper 1: Listening, Reading and Writing/Translation (50% of A level) Paper 2: Writing (20% of A level) Paper 3: Speaking (30% of A level)
